Role of mineral additions in reducing CO_2 emission

The influence of substitution of a part of clinker with the mineral additions, in the process of production of mixed cement, on mechanical characteristics of cement and the reduction of CO_2 emission is researched. Experiments are organized through the production of clinker, which has different phase structures, and cement, using diferent kinds of amount of mineral additions, with joint grinding and addition to the already ground cement. The most important of the effects analyzed, which include the reduction of thermal and electric energy, in the reduction of CO_2 emission.
